diff --git a/aethex-bot/migrations/create_all_tables.sql b/aethex-bot/migrations/create_all_tables.sql index 9c2aedd..0487b13 100644 --- a/aethex-bot/migrations/create_all_tables.sql +++ b/aethex-bot/migrations/create_all_tables.sql @@ -500,8 +500,9 @@ CREATE INDEX IF NOT EXISTS idx_user_stats_guild ON user_stats(guild_id); CREATE INDEX IF NOT EXISTS idx_periodic_xp_period ON periodic_xp(period_type, period_start); CREATE INDEX IF NOT EXISTS idx_warnings_guild ON warnings(guild_id); CREATE INDEX IF NOT EXISTS idx_mod_actions_guild ON mod_actions(guild_id); --- Note: Index on giveaways will be created after table exists with correct columns -CREATE INDEX IF NOT EXISTS idx_scheduled_messages_send ON scheduled_messages(send_at) WHERE sent = false; +-- Partial indexes (run after tables exist if needed) +-- CREATE INDEX IF NOT EXISTS idx_giveaways_ends ON giveaways(ends_at) WHERE ended = false; +-- CREATE INDEX IF NOT EXISTS idx_scheduled_messages_send ON scheduled_messages(send_at) WHERE sent = false; -- ============ RLS POLICIES ============